Calories and Nutrition Notes
Because Chatham Cafe operates primarily as local, independent businesses rather than a massive national chain with 20+ locations, official corporate nutritional disclosures are not required by federal law and are not published. The figures in this guide are estimates based on standard culinary preparations.
| Menu Area | Nutrition Note | Best For | Source Confidence |
|---|---|---|---|
| Black Coffee & Cold Brew | Almost entirely calorie-free (5-15 kcal) when ordered black. | Strict calorie counting | High (Standard coffee) |
| Lattes & Macchiatos | Milk and flavored syrups quickly add 150-300+ calories. Sugar-free syrups help reduce the load. | Treat days | Medium (Depends on barista pours) |
| Breakfast Sandwiches | Choosing a wrap or sourdough saves calories over butter croissants or dense bagels. | Protein tracking | Medium (Estimates only) |
Allergen and Dietary Notes
While individual ingredient sourcing varies by the specific cafe you visit, standard dietary accommodations are typically available. Always inform the staff directly of severe food allergies before ordering.
| Dietary Need | What to Check | Important Note |
|---|---|---|
| Dairy-Free / Vegan | Check if Oat, Almond, or Soy milk is available for espresso drinks. | Plant milks usually carry a small upcharge ($0.75 - $0.85). |
| Gluten-Free | Ask for gluten-free bread or wrap substitutes for breakfast and lunch sandwiches. | Kitchens are shared; cross-contact with gluten in toasters or on grills is highly likely. |
| Nut Allergies | Check bakery items, pesto (often nut-based), and flavored drink syrups (hazelnut/almond). | Steam wands used for almond milk are often the same ones used for regular milk. Ask the barista to wipe/purge the wand. |
